How Indigenous Enterprise is highlighting their culture and bringing traditional dance around the world.

The group’s latest engagement is a weeklong show at the Joyce Theater in New York, which runs until November 14. Titled “Indigenous Liberation,” the new showcase offers a diverse look at Indigenous dance styles, all performed to music from popular Indigenous groups such as Northern Cree, the Wild Band of Comanches, and Bull Horn.

The men’s fancy war dance Shirley performs, meanwhile, is from the Ponca and Comanche tribes. “It’s representative of a horse,” he says. “In the beginning, it was a really slow, laid-back style of dancing. Then [American soldier] Buffalo Bill wanted to bring dancers overseas, and he asked them to make it more fancy and exciting for the audiences. Now you’ll see a lot of us doing cartwheels and fast footwork.

While “Indigenous Liberation” finishes its New York run at the end of week, its dancers plan to continue carrying forward their traditions and introducing them to new audiences around the globe. “New York City is full of culture, and to be able to bring our Native American culture to it—it feels good to be that representation,” says Lodgepole. “We strive off that type of energy.” The dancers agree that their art is bigger than themselves.
